The hydraulic classification of kaolin includes spiral classification (separation of +1mm coarse sand), sedimentation tank classification (separation of +0.053mm fine sand), hydrocyclone classification (separation of -0.053mm fine sand), centrifugal classifier or small-diameter hydrocyclone classification (for ultrafine particle classification of 0.002 ~ 0.010mm). Kaolin high gradient PTMS magnetic separator process uses a magnetic medium to generate a magnetic field intensity of more than 1600kA/m, removes Fe2O3 and TiO2 in kaolin, and produces paper coatings and advanced ceramic materials.

PTMS magnetic separator process for kaolin selective flocculation, by adding flocculant, selective separation of fine quartz, pyrite, alum and other impurities, to produce scraper coated kaolin. The commonly used flocculants are sodium hexametaphosphate, polyacrylamide, sodium silicate and so on.

Chemical bleaching process of kaolin PTMS magnetic separator. Add insurance powder and other bleach agent to reduce the high value iron of limonite and hematite in kaolin to soluble ferrous iron, or add oxidizing agent to oxidize pyrite and dyeing impurities to improve the whiteness of kaolin.
